Cognitive Resource Theory
A theory that examines how stress levels and the intellectual abilities of a leader impact their decision-making process and leadership effectiveness.
High Stress
A condition or situation characterized by a high level of tension, anxiety, or strain, often resulting from demanding circumstances or challenges.
Leadership Effectiveness
The capability of a leader to inspire, motivate, and foster the desired outcomes within their team or organization.
Contingency Theories
A set of leadership theories suggesting that the effectiveness of a leader's style or strategy depends on situational factors and context.
